on both of mine i just bought a 24" stainless tube from grainger.com and some 5200. drill a hole with a LONG drill bit through the hull underneath the steering cable location and push the stainless tube through it, then seal up everything with 5200. run the cable through, get it all adjusted in place, and then use some adhesive silicone to seal up the cable in the tube.

assuming you have the drill bit and trim cable, you can install the tube for roughly 30 bucks (tube, 5200, and adhesive silicone). i think i used thin walled 1/2" OD stainless tube..cost around 12 shipped from grainger

I have a solas pump on my sxr. I used a cooling line pipe for my cable. trimmed out the exit nozzle for pull trim up. How ever you may need to put a small piece of rubber or some sort of spacer behind you drive shaft in you pump. It seems the pump is set back a little. This will keep drive shaft from walking back away from your coupler and possible separating will under power
